Log:
Revert r363191 "[MS] Pretend constexpr variable template specializations are inline"

The next Visual Studio update will fix this issue, and it doesn't make
sense to implement this non-conforming behavior going forward.

@@ -9809,25 +9809,10 @@ static GVALinkage basicGVALinkageForVari
     return StrongLinkage;
 
   case TSK_ExplicitSpecialization:
-    if (Context.getTargetInfo().getCXXABI().isMicrosoft()) {
-      // If this is a fully specialized constexpr variable template, pretend it
-      // was marked inline. MSVC 14.21.27702 headers define _Is_integral in a
-      // header this way, and we don't want to emit non-discardable definitions
-      // of these variables in every TU that includes <type_traits>. This
-      // behavior is non-conforming, since another TU could use an extern
-      // template declaration for this variable, but for constexpr variables,
-      // it's unlikely for a user to want to do that. This behavior can be
-      // removed if the headers change to explicitly mark such variable template
-      // specializations inline.
-      if (isa<VarTemplateSpecializationDecl>(VD) && VD->isConstexpr())
-        return GVA_DiscardableODR;
-
-      // Use ODR linkage for static data members of fully specialized templates
-      // to prevent duplicate definition errors with MSVC.
-      if (VD->isStaticDataMember())
-        return GVA_StrongODR;
-    }
-    return StrongLinkage;
+    return Context.getTargetInfo().getCXXABI().isMicrosoft() &&
+                   VD->isStaticDataMember()
+               ? GVA_StrongODR
+               : StrongLinkage;
 
   case TSK_ExplicitInstantiationDefinition:
     return GVA_StrongODR;
